Auto-generated workspace names walked the marine-creature list in order
and deduped only within the active repo (the default when workspaces are
nested), so the first auto-named worktree in every repo landed on
"Nautilus". That guaranteed identical branch names across repos, which
appear flat and indistinguishable in the sidebar.
The in-order walk also produced "Nautilus-2", "Nautilus-3", ... within a
single repo: the suggester ignores branches left behind by deleted
worktrees, so it kept re-proposing "Nautilus", and the create-time retry
loop suffixed it to dodge the lingering branch. Random selection now
yields a fresh creature each time instead of marching the same name.
- Dedup against worktrees in every repo, not just the active one
- Pick randomly from the unused pool instead of the first list entry
- Lowercase the result to match branch-name convention (fix/seahorse)
- Expand the corpus 260 -> 552 (more marine species plus public-domain
mythological sea creatures) so random picks rarely repeat
getSuggestedCreatureName drops the now-unused repoId/nestWorkspaces
params; the RNG is injectable for deterministic tests.

When pairing fails (e.g. broken Tailscale route, firewall blocking the
WS, expired token, etc.) the mobile app previously got stuck on
'Connecting…' forever with no signal about *where* it stalled.
Adds a structured connection-log stream from the rpc client and renders
it under the 'Connecting…' spinner on both pair-scan and pair-confirm.
Each phase emits a timestamped, color-coded entry: Opening WebSocket,
WebSocket open, Sent e2ee_hello, Received e2ee_ready, Authenticated,
WebSocket closed / Reconnect scheduled / Connect timeout / Handshake
timeout, etc. The log auto-scrolls and stays visible after a failure so
the user can see the last successful step.
Also fixes the silent infinite spinner: pairing now has a 25s overall
timeout — rpc-client retries forever by design (right behaviour for
live sessions), but for the *initial* pair we want a hard ceiling that
surfaces an actionable error with the log visible instead of spinning.
- Adds ConnectionLogEntry / ConnectionLogSink to transport/types.ts
- connect() now accepts { onStateChange, onLog } (legacy fn form kept)
- New ConnectionLog component (mono, level-coloured, +Xs elapsed)
- Pair flows track logs in a ref and render them in connecting/error
- 25s pairing-overall timeout that closes the client and surfaces a
'see log below for where it stalled' error
